Science in Action – Live Broadcast at Denver Museum of Nature & Science

The Science in Action distance learning program connects students directly with active Denver Museum of Nature & Science scientists and their research.  This is a  unique opportunity via an interactive live broadcast between students and scientists that offers students a window into the world of fieldwork and a behind-the-scenes look into research laboratories. 

 During the 30-minute broadcast, scientists talk about the importance of field research in making new discoveries, demonstrate some of the field techniques they use in that research, and answer questions from the students. The goal of this live exchange is to encourage critical thinking by the students about the process of science and how scientific discoveries are made.  Teachers and students receive resource prep materials to become familiar with the scientists research and to help students develop questions to ask the scientists.    

October 4th:  choose one session10:00 am Dr John Demboski – biologist with a research focus on the genetic variation of small mammals, such as chipmunks.  Ask him anything related. 11:15 am Dr Paula Cushing – biologist with a research focus on the diversity of arachnids (spiders and their relatives). Ask her anything related. The FREE scholarships are for schools in Adams, Arapahoe, Boulder, Broomfield, Denver and Jefferson counties.
